LOUISVILLE, Ky. (WAVE) - Team Kentucky is celebrating a big showing at the Special Olympics USA Games, bringing home more than three dozen medals across eight sports. Crestwood native Justin Hale helped lead the way, earning three gold medals in swimming in the 50-yard butterfly, 200-yard medley, and a team relay.

A grieving mother in Louisville, Kentucky, put out homicide awareness flyers for her daughter and her roommate, two teenagers who were tragically shot dead. She did so outside the business where the alleged killer works, but the owner went outside and tore the flyers down, even though he didn’t have any right to do so.

Weekend flooding highlights persistent problems with Kentucky dam safety

Residents of a Bullitt County road were urged to evacuate after a landslide at a small dam. Its owner says she didn’t know of previous government inspections.
